To add another page in Microsoft Word, you can simply press "Ctrl + Enter" on your keyboard, which inserts a page break. Alternatively, you can go to the "Insert" tab in the ribbon and click on "Blank Page." This will create a new page at the current cursor location.

I don't know about mapquest, but a printer friendly button usually opens a new window. On this window, the main part of the page wanted for printing is shown. Any advertising, decorations, etc, around the page edges are removed, so cutting down the printing to the minimum, thereby, saving ink.
A login page can be either a dialog page or a window page depending on the design and implementation of the website or application. In a dialog page, the login fields are displayed within a pop-up or overlay on the same page, while in a window page, the login fields are presented in a separate browser window or tab. Both approaches are commonly used in web development based on design and user experience preferences.
The bar that shows page numbers in Microsoft Word is called the "Status Bar." It is located at the bottom of the Word window and displays various information, including the current page number, total page count, word count, and other relevant statistics. You can customize the Status Bar to show or hide specific information according to your preferences.
It is possible to have more than one window open. Think of a window almost like the page of a book; in a book, you can have a page open that you are reading, and you can have another page marked with a bookmark further through the book, ready for you to go to easily. In a similar way, an active window is a program that is in use (like the book page that you are reading) and inactive window is a program that is not in use (like the page you do not have open but have placed a bookmark for ready access).
